Water

Water is an Irrigation controller web app for EtherRain devices. For more details about the EtherRain Networked Sprinkler Controller, please visit http://www.quicksmart.com/qs_etherrain.html.

Setup

I have not streamlined the setup process (yet...), but here is a guideline of what needs to be done.

Database

Water uses a SQLite database. To create the database, run setup.php. The database can be reset by deleting db/data.db and re-running setup.php.

Configuration file

In config.php:

// EtherRain device settings
$ipaddress = "192.168.0.1";
$port = 8080;
$simulated = true;
$amount_per_min = 0.635;
$num_zones = 2;

This includes the network location of the EtherRain device; it is how the web server will interact with the device. You can choose to simulate the device instead of actually triggering a device. Amount per minute is how many mm of water the lawn gets per minute of watering, and number of zones is used to calculate how much watering time is left.

// Location settings (for time and weather)
$timezone = "America/Edmonton";
$location = "calgary,canada";

This is the physical location of the EtherRain device. It is used to determine time and weather.

// For worldweatheronline.com
$api_key = "get_key_from_worldweatheronline.com";

This is for the weather source. It is required.

Cron Job

Add a cron job to run cron.php while in its directory every 5 minutes. Optionally, log the output by appending it to a file. Weather will be updated on the hour.

*/5 * * * * cd /path/to/water/; php -q cron.php >> cron_log.txt;
